CVE-2021-42141: Critical severity Contiki-NG tinyDTLS vulnerability

An issue was discovered in Contiki-NG tinyDTLS through 2018-08-30. One incorrect handshake could complete with different epoch numbers in the packets ClientHello, Clientkeyexchange, and Changecipherspec, which may cause denial of service.
